(Deadline extended) 1708 Gallery invites proposals for “InLight Richmond 2010″

June 19, 2009 10:00 am to July 2, 2009 11:59 pm


Peter Culley, “Light House_1_Jackson Ward.”
PHOTO BY JON-PHILIP SHERIDAN

Richmond’s 1708 Gallery invites established and emerging artists working in all media and disciplines to submit proposals for the upcoming “InLight Richmond 2010,” a show of artwork inspired by light, which will take place October 22 in downtown Richmond. Preferences will be given to proposals that involve, investigate, interpret, or are inspired by light, either as a medium or as an abstract idea. Existing work, as well as proposals for new projects will be considered. The work will be selected by guest juror Adelina Vlas, Assistant Curator of Modern and Contemporary Art at the Philadelphia Museum of Art. Cash awards. Deadline for entry is June 21, 2010. Entry fee $30. For more information, visit InLight 2009. 1708 Gallery, 319 W. Broad St., Richmond. 804-643-1708.
